Defining the risk factors for acute, subacute and chronic cough: a cross-sectional study in a Finnish adult employee population.
Anne M LättiJuha PekkanenHeikki Olavi KoskelaPublished in: BMJ open (2018)
The specific risk factors for chronic cough were oesophageal reflux disease and advanced age. Acute and subacute cough should not be regarded merely as symptoms of acute respiratory infections but possible manifestations of long-standing risk factors. A new risk factor for all cough types was family history of chronic cough.
